Transaction 2123eebac821513836ece56425d814c34b8b7227dd2a27045ab4969bfac90e80

1 Input
2 Outputs
  • 2123eebac821513836ece56425d814c34b8b7227dd2a27045ab4969bfac90e80:0
  • value  509424
    address  1B8QbgmJGpZNLstArFYRVBZaNRXHm9y9ec
  • 2123eebac821513836ece56425d814c34b8b7227dd2a27045ab4969bfac90e80:1
  • value  19350102
    address  1J29RLyBUkMx2w2z69sttd4A22J8JG3jU